Output db61f665eb659506c7a9977830a9fb4405009120833bd09e135940649b07af14:0

value
123163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010b8133559521e1f369642f0fb27b60b94d039b OP_EQUAL
address
31nYP6VGmqgsY4aosCXyybbkoDnjBdyGqV
transaction
db61f665eb659506c7a9977830a9fb4405009120833bd09e135940649b07af14
confirmations
365680
spent
true